Pedestrian Struck And Killed Near Felton Wednesday

Felton- Delaware State Police are investigating a fatal pedestrian accident that occurred last night in the Felton area, according to Public Information Officer, Master Corporal Heather Pepper.

Pepper said on September 30, 2020, at approximately 8:00 p.m., a 2000 Dodge Dakota operated by a 28-year-old man from Felton, was traveling southbound on US 13 in the left lane of travel, approaching Bork Drive. The 65-year-old male pedestrian from Felton, who was wearing dark clothing was reported to be lying in the roadway, in the southbound lane, in the same area. The operator failed to see the pedestrian lying in the roadway and subsequently hit him, said Pepper. After the collision, the Dakota came to a controlled stop and waited on scene.

The pedestrian was pronounced deceased at the scene. Identification is pending notification of next to kin.

The operator was not injured in the accident.

US 13 southbound was closed for approximately 3.5 hours during the investigation.
